Antoine Dinkel is a human[1]. He was born in Mulhouse[2]. He was born on +1914-10-25T00:00:00Z[3]. He died in Cannes[4]. He died on +1974-03-28T00:00:00Z[5]. He worked as an entrepreneur[6] and politician[7].

- Antoine Dinkel held the position of Mayor of Saint-Étienne-lès-Remiremont[10].
- Antoine Dinkel received the Order of Social Merit[11].
- Antoine Dinkel received the Honour medal for work service[12].
- Antoine Dinkel received the Resistance Medal[13].
- Antoine Dinkel was a member of Maquis du Haut-du-Bois[14].
